Output 5f3e690daa626be0cd4810462ffb6e189b05dab51a0ead55b8a94ec13f08305e:5

value
122860
script pubkey
OP_0 OP_PUSHBYTES_20 b15df6332f2bc65026cf92263409a9647756560e
address
tb1qk9wlvve090r9qfk0jgnrgzdfv3m4v4swan9c2s
transaction
5f3e690daa626be0cd4810462ffb6e189b05dab51a0ead55b8a94ec13f08305e
confirmations
6691
spent
true